I. BASIC OBEDIENCE
This course is recommended
by us for ALL dogs. It is designed to teach the owner how to train and
communicate with his or her dog. The verbal commands for any level of training
may be taught in the German or English language. The commands for heel, sit,
stay, down, and come are all covered within this course. During the course, the
owner will have the opportunity to discuss other problems which may be occurring
at home with the dog (e.g., housebreaking, chewing, etc.) and will be advised by
the trainer on how to deal with them. The owner will be taught both verbal and
hand signals for each command. In addition, a closer bond will be established
between dog and owner.
II. ADVANCED
OBEDIENCE
This course is for the dog
owner who desires professional dog training assistance in teaching the dog
obedience both off lead and at a distance. Obedience under more difficult
distractions are introduced and polished at this level. Much emphasis is place
on precision during the work, and any special requests for additional commands
can also be covered.
III. PROTECTION
This course is for the owner
who desires aggression on command from the dog. The dog is taught to be
defensive and protective in the home, and automobile if desired. In addition,
the dog is taught to respond to threats to himself or his family. Bite training
for this level is optional. At the completion of this course, the owner can
expect the dog to exhibit more confidence.
IV. ATTACK
All previous levels of
training must be passed before beginning this course. The individual dog must
also exhibit the proper stability and intelligence required. Level 4 is an
offensive mode, and is not ordinarily suggested for home use. The dog is taught
an offensive assault, and is actually educated in the combat of a person or
persons. He is taught to use the full potential of his jaw pressure in biting an
assailant. Command protection and recall are covered both on and off lead.
Muzzle work for this level of training is optional. At the completion of this
course, the dog will reach a level of maximum aggression and confidence when aroused,
but should always display absolute obedience and clear headed stability in
normal daily living. At the completion of this course, the bond between dog and
owner will be extremely pronounced.
V. POLICE PATROL
This is a specialized
course, taking the dog through the Level 4 attack work and then modifying the
training to suit the department, or individual officer's personal needs. Police
dog training may include any or all phases of police K-9 training such as
tracking, air scenting, pursuit/hold at bay, search and seizure, prisoner
transport, building search, crowd control, narcotics detection, bomb detection,
poison proofing, obstacle agility work, etc.
VI. SCHUTZHUND
This course is designed to
train the dog for competition in the German sport of "schutzhund". The
dog will learn the needed tracking, obedience, and protection exercises in order
to compete for the level of schutzhund in which he qualifies.
VII. SECURITY
This level of training is
reserved only for area or building security. It is not the type of training that
is practical for home protection. The dog is taught to attack virtually anyone
who enters his area. He will be trained to allow only one or two specific people
to approach him, so that he may be taken at the end of his shift, back to his
living quarters. The dog can also be taught to refuse poisoned food and a avoid
any other attempts or tactics to alleviate him from his duty.
